Nearby Towns and Attractions
Crimdon Dene Holiday Park is conveniently located near the towns of Hartlepool and Peterlee. Hartlepool is known for its rich maritime history, highlighted by the fascinating Hartlepool's Maritime Experience, and offers a variety of shops and dining options. Peterlee, a bustling town with beautiful parks and local amenities, is also nearby. Families will love visiting Tweddle Children's Animal Farm for a day of interacting with friendly animals and enjoying farm activities.
Exploring Durham's Heritage
The park's location in Durham offers access to some of the region's most notable attractions. A short drive away, you'll find the historic Durham Castle, a UNESCO World Heritage Site that offers a glimpse into the area's medieval past.
